About the Opportunity
WISDOM Journal is inviting original and unpublished book chapter submissions for an upcoming edited volume titled “Law in the Age of AI: Rights, Risks and Reforms”.
The volume will explore how Artificial Intelligence is reshaping legal systems, governance, and the protection of fundamental rights. It will address the opportunities and challenges presented by intelligent technologies and examine reforms needed to promote justice, equity, and human dignity.

Submission Guidelines
- The chapter should be between 1,200 and 1,500 words, excluding the abstract and references.
- The abstract should be 150 words.
- Submissions must follow the OSCOLA citation style.
- Co-authorship is permitted, with a maximum of three authors.
- Use of AI is strictly prohibited under the submission guidelines.
- The plagiarism limit is below 10%.
- Decisions of the Review Panel shall be final and binding.
